"Children’s Book and Small Press Publishing"
Introduces participants to book layout, format, and design. Tips regarding marketing, book buyers, distribution channels, media contacts, and the benefits associated with collaborating with special events are reviewed, as are economic feasible short runs. The workshop also covers domestic suppliers, printers, and the economic feasibility of short runs, and copyrighting processes.
“Developing a Picture Perfect Portfolio”
Allows anyone with an interest in photography to familiarize themselves with the process of publishing the still image. This workshop covers how to get one’s photographs published in both local and national newspapers and magazines. Topics include how to research one’s special niche and how to query publications for submission guidelines. The basic laws of photography, including contracts, releases, and copyrighting are also reviewed.
